Mauricio Pochettino is reportedly set to raid his former club Tottenham for Hugo Lloris and Dele Alli once appointed as Paris Saint-Germain manager.
Pochettino will become the new PSG boss following the ruthless sacking of Thomas Tuchel on Christmas Eve.
And the 48-year-old plans to return to his old team for reinforcements with the transfer window reopening on January 2.
According to Eurosport, he's eyeing goalkeeper Lloris and out-of-favour midfielder Alli, who has been the subject of intense transfer speculation since the start of the new season.

PSG have kept tabs on Alli for months and Pochettino could pounce when he's announced as the club's new manager.
The Argentine is also looking at Lloris whose been at Spurs since 2012.

Jose Mourinho, though, is unlikely to listen to offers for the Frenchman who's the club's No.1 and captain.
The reports also claims Serge Aurier and Harry Winks could also 'crop up at some stage' as transfer targets.
Former Spurs star Christian Eriksen, who played under 'Poch', has also been touted as a potential signing for PSG.

The Dane is up for sale with Inter Milan prepared to offload him in January.
